About Ed
I have several years experience of private tutoring in English, History, Politics and Sociology, and English as a Foreign Language. At university, I completed a Bachelor’s degree in Politics and International Relations with First-Class Honours and a Master’s Degree in International Relations with a Distinction, both from the University of Bristol. My passion for tutoring comes from having seen first-hand the transformative impact that extra care and attention can have on a student's confidence, self-perception, and academic achievement. At a time when so many students' needs are not being met within schools, I want to be there to give the extra boost required to push students to the next level.

My approach to tutoring is based on empathy, patience, and taking the time to develop personalised lesson plans that inspire passion and unlock the potential of every student. This is based on 5 years of experience as a freelance private tutor in various subjects, as well as in time spent working in academic and pastoral support roles in a Sixth Form College. My lessons usually last for an hour but this can be adjusted based on student needs. I have mostly worked with students who struggle with the subject either due to unrecognised accessibility needs, low confidence, or difficulties with the rigidity of the school curriculum. However, I am just as comfortable working with high-achieving students that want to take their work to the next level. In my first lesson with any student, I will focus on identifying the specific things they struggle with and develop tailored tasks that combine understanding of required content with building confidence in these areas. Rather than taking this initial conversation as a rigid guide, in future lessons I always check in with how they feel about these struggles, whether the methods we are using to address them need adjusting, and if new problems have emerged that they hadn't realised before. From my experience, students respond best when they are treated with respect and given the space to develop their maturity alongside their grades. Every student deserves the opportunity to succeed in a supportive environment, and with my tutoring they will get it.
